def to_binary(n: int, width: int) -> str:
"""Formats ``n`` as exactly ``width`` binary digits, including when ``width`` is 0"""
n = operator.index(n)
width = operator.index(width)
if n not in range(1 << width):
raise ValueError(f"{n} does not fit in {width} bits")
if width == 0:
return ""
return f"{n:0{width}b}"
